Something you have to know about my Grandpa, a story about his life that makes me so proud to say I'm his granddaughter... This story is one I remember hearing around the time of his funeral, as we celebrated his life and the difference he made to so many of us and probably to many people I'll never meet.

So the story is this:
Grandpa was a farmer.. As far as I know, his livelihood was working the ground, planting in the spring, and harvesting in the fall. This involved planting seeds: either corn or soybeans into the dirt, and allowing God to do the rest.

As he eased into retirement, grandpa became more involved in the Bible League, a group that helps bring Bibles into the hands of people who need them in their native language all around the world... He still spent a good amount of time in the field, working the ground, and planting those seeds.
He and grandma traveled to Russia, Thailand, the Phillipines, India, and other places I can't even remember. . It brought him so much joy to interact with people from other countries, listen to their stories, and learn about how they came to know Jesus Christ as Lord.
Grandpa also had a knack for remembering people. I swear.. he knew this guy, and that one.. He'd say, "Mr. Neochimrangcharahong from Thailand said this" etc.... (Sorry Mr. Neo if I got your name wrong..)
So, as I look back ag grandpa's life, he never really stopped planting seeds.. He just started to do it in a different way, and for a bigger purpose. God used him to bring the LOVE of JESUS to people all over the world..
I'd like to think that God is going to get Grandpa in on the great Gathering that will happen when Jesus returns for all of us. What a wonderful harvest that will be!
